A420 vll, 60 hz, 3-phase, y-connected, 4 pole induction motor is running at rated voltage and current. the rotor speed is 1720 rpm. the stator resistance and leakage reactance may be neglected. when the motor runs at no load, the speed is approximately 1800 rpm and the stator line current (magnitude) is 5 amps. the rotor resistance referred to the stator (rr) is 0.8 ohms. the rotor leakage reactance referred to the stator (xir) is 2.0 ohms.
(a) what is the frequency of the rotor current at this operating point (1720 rpm)?
(b) what is the rated line current magnitude?
(c) what is the starting line current magnitude if started at full rated voltage?
(d) what is the rated torque?
(e) what is the maximum possible torque this motor can deliver?
(f) what is the rotor speed (in rpm) at which this maximum torque occurs?
